Keystone's Morning Wake-Up 8/8/13

China trade data has the bulls running today with copper leading higher. Copper, commodities and semiconductors are the key market movers currently. Watch JJC 39.00 (now above causing bullishness and copper is headed even higher), GTX 4795 (now below causing market negativity) and SOX 473.36 (now above causing market bullishness). The bears need to drag copper and semi's lower while the bulls need to send commodities higher. Keybot the Quant is short and today will determine if a whipsaw back to the long side occurs, or not. A push above SPX 1695 may place the bulls back in the drivers seat.  For the SPX starting at 1691, the bulls need 1695 and higher to create an upside acceleration. The futures point to this occurring in the opening minutes so watch to see if the higher numbers hold, or not. The bears need to push under 1685 to accelerate the downside. A move through 1686-1694 is sideways action today. The 8 MA is below the 34 MA on the SPX 30-minute chart signaling bearish markets ahead, however, the 8 MA is sloping upwards and the bulls are going to try and create a positive 8/34 cross today to regain market control.  The SPX held the 20-day MA support at 1690.05 yesterday.
